Obituary -- Dr. M. P. Willis, 64 years old, died shortly after noon today at his home at 105 North Maple Street, Commerce Oklahoma. His death climaxed an illness of several years. No funeral arrangements could be learned this afternoon.

Miami News Record — Miami, OK

Feb 02 1934 · p.1 · col.4

Obituary -- Funeral services were conducted at 2 o'clock yesterday afternoon from the First Baptist church for Dr. M. P. Willis who died Friday afternoon following a long illness. Dr. J. E. Hampton, pastor of the Miami Baptist church assisted by the Rev. C. A. Simmons, pastor of the local Methodist church conducted the services. Mr. H. B. Ralph sang "One Sweetly Solemn Thought." Noel W. Wyatt sang "There'll Be No Tears in Paradise" and a sextette composed of Mrs. J. C. Denton, Miss Sara Johnson, Mrs. H. B. Ralph, Mrs. W. S. Nelson, J. W. Valentine and Elmer Fulcher sang "No Night There." Pallbearers were members of the Ottawa County Medical Society of which Dr. Willis was a member. Fifteen young women acted as flower girls. A large crowd of friends paid their last tribute to the deceased, the church being filled before the hour of the funeral and many were forced to stand. The body was laid to rest in G.A.R. cemetery of Miami.

Miami News Record — Miami, OK

Feb 05 1934 · p.6 · col.5
